Employee digital training as a related cost in digitalization projects
There is no single answer. The same usage course is an eligible related cost in one programme, an excluded cost in another, and the entire object of funding in a third.
The question of whether employee training is an eligible cost usually gets a generic yes. The programme documents are blunter. Under SME Eco-Tech, open until 24 September 2026, staff training appears on the ineligible list of the implementation procedure, alongside commissioning, assembly and labour. Under the PNRR C9 call for SME digitalization, now closed and in implementation, employee training was among the eligible categories, next to websites, ERP, licences and cybersecurity. At the other extreme, Investment 19 of PNRR component C7, managed by the Romanian Digitalization Authority, granted de minimis aid of at most 17,000 euro per SME exclusively in the form of training programmes, with implementation closing on 31 December 2025 — there training was not a related cost but the whole object of the funding. Verified on 30 July 2026: we re-checked the three regimes and the authority's announcement for the PEO call on digital skills, where MySMIS2021 opened on 28 May 2024 at 16:00 and submissions closed on 23 August 2024 at 16:00, with no extension and no later round. The practical conclusion for a budget: the treatment of training is read in the guide of your own call, never assumed from another.

Three different regimes, in three programmes
Regime one — training as a cost related to the system. This is the most frequent case in digitalization schemes: the course accompanies a new system and is budgeted in the same project. That is how the PNRR C9 call treated it, listing employee training next to websites, online stores, ERP and CRM, licences, cloud services, automation and cybersecurity.
Regime two — training excluded outright. Under SME Eco-Tech the implementation procedure lists staff training among ineligible costs, together with commissioning, assembly and labour. For a software component that means the service side stays entirely with the company, even though the product is reimbursed.
Regime three — training as the object of the funding. Investment 19 of PNRR C7, managed by the Romanian Digitalization Authority, granted up to 17,000 euro per SME as de minimis aid, exclusively as training programmes in nine technology fields, with implementation closing on 31 December 2025. No licence and no software development could be bought with that money.
The fourth case is not a regime but a warning about the calendar: a dedicated training call is not open merely because it once existed. The digital-skills call under the Education and Employment Programme, managed by MIPE, received projects in MySMIS2021 from 28 May 2024 at 16:00 until 23 August 2024 at 16:00, and the authority's announcement carries no extension and no later round. On training as the exclusive object of funding we can confirm no open session as at 30 July 2026, and that changes the planning: the training line is budgeted inside the investment project or from own funds, not in anticipation of a dedicated call.
How we size and document training inside a project
Our practical rule: every delivered module gets sessions for its direct users, plus one session for the system's internal administrator. Calculating by hours and participants produces a defensible figure — neither symbolic nor inflated against the value of the system.
What does not work is a round percentage of the project value with no content behind it. Training is the only line in a software vendor's budget that leaves no technical artefact behind, so its documentation has to be built in advance rather than reconstructed afterwards.
At the end we run a short usage assessment: each participant performs the basic operations in the system. The result goes into the protocol and becomes the adoption evidence that monitoring reports often ask for during the sustainability period.
Where our role stops
Northdan Soft is not an accredited training provider and does not run certified courses. The training we deliver is usage training on the system we build. If your budget needs a certified training line, it cannot come from us and must be contracted from an accredited provider.
The limit that costs us: where the guide excludes training, we do not relabel it as documentation, configuration or technical assistance on the invoice so that it fits the reimbursable part. The refusal means a smaller invoice for us and an extra own-funds amount for the client — and it is far cheaper than an invoice line that does not describe what was actually delivered.
Frequently asked questions
Is employee training eligible in digitalization projects?
It depends on the call, and the difference is real. Under the PNRR C9 call for SME digitalization, employee training was among the eligible categories; under SME Eco-Tech, staff training appears explicitly on the ineligible list of the implementation procedure. Read the guide of the call you are submitting under, not a general list.
What do I do if my programme does not reimburse training?
It is budgeted separately, from own funds or from the investment loan if the financier accepts it there. What is not done is moving it into a licence, configuration or documentation line: the real nature of the service is visible in the contract, the protocols and the course materials.
How is the training budget calculated in a software costing?
By session: number of participants, hours, syllabus per role and course materials, with a separate session for the system's internal administrator. Training sized against real modules and real users can be compared with the market; an arbitrary percentage of the project value offers nothing to compare.
Which documents prove training at reimbursement?
Attendance sheets signed by participants with the date and duration; the course materials handed over, versioned and dated; the protocol of each session with the syllabus covered; and a final assessment in which users perform real operations in the system. The last item also serves later as evidence of use during the sustainability period.
